Ingredients

Weights computed by us.

907 g2 pounds beef chuck roast (or stewing beef, cut into 1-inch chunks)
22 g3 tablespoons all-purpose flour
6 g1 teaspoon salt
1 g1/2 teaspoon black pepper
1 g1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
41 g3 tablespoons olive oil (divided)
150 g1 yellow onion (chopped)
960 g4 cups beef broth (divided, or beef stock *see note)
450 g3 cups diced potatoes (peeled*)
122 g2 large carrots (cut into 1-inch pieces, about 2 cups)
120 g3 ribs celery (cut into 1-inch pieces, about 1 cup)
1 cup vegetable juice (such as V8)
16 g1 tablespoon Worcestershire sauce
2 g1 teaspoon dried rosemary (or 1 sprig fresh)
1 g1/2 teaspoon dried thyme leaves (or 2 sprigs fresh thyme)
16 g2 tablespoons cornstarch
30 g2 tablespoons water
109 g3/4 cup frozen peas
salt and black pepper (to taste)
